工具 node-nightly
全局安装
npm install --global node-nightly执行一次命令
node-nightlynode 执行文件时带上
--inspect标记,例如:node --inspect mian.js一般用
--inspect-brk代替--inspect标记,会在程序第一行代码处自动断点。-
点击蓝色
inspect就会跳到正常网页开发断点的sources页面,进行断点。可以在
package.json的scripts添加"debugger": "node --inspect-brk build/build.js",执行命令npm run debugger如果你有多个配置文件,你可以通过
--config webpack.prod.js指定你想要调试的配置。例如:node --inspect --inspect-brk node_modules/webpack/bin/webpack --config ./webpack.prod.config.jsnode --inspect-brk node_modules/webpack-dev-server/bin/webpack-dev-server.js --inline --progress --mode development --config ./build/webpack.dev.conf.jsvuecli3 中:
node --inspect-brk node_modules/@vue/cli-service/bin/vue-cli-service.js serve
注意: 进行webpack开发时需要将webpack 升级到"webpack": "4.3.0"或以上。
